代码重构

开搜AI为您找到8个科技领域问答内容,共有189名用户找到解决方法,更多关于科技领域问题,使用开搜直达结果
浏览量:189
这一年我优化了一个46万行的超级系统
在2024年7月22日,作者河畔一角分享了他在这一年中优化一个46万行代码的超级系统的经历。他提到,这个系统经过了一年的优化,从基层做起,包括代码优化、组件封装、基础夯实、服务拆分和性能提升。这个过程让他感到非常充实,但也让他感到疲惫。 以下是一些相关的细节和背景信息: 代码优化:作者提到了对代码的优化,这通常包括重构代码、消除冗余、提高代
写一个算法将ScheduleJobLog字符串变成jobLog,js实现,也就是把之前的驼峰去掉
字符串转换算法 将字符串 ScheduleJobLog 转换为 jobLog.js 的算法可以通过以下步骤实现: 识别并去除驼峰:首先识别字符串中的大写字母,并将它们转换为小写。 添加文件扩展名:在转换后的字符串后添加 .js 扩展名。 具体实现步骤 要点一**:使用正则表达式匹配所有大写
0引用代码删减 java
在Java开发中,代码优化是一个持续的过程,旨在提高程序的性能和效率。以下是一些引用代码删减的技巧和建议,这些技巧可以帮助提升Java代码的运行效率: 指定final修饰符:尽量为类和方法指定final修饰符,这可以提高代码的运行效率。带有final修饰符的类是不可派生的,这有助于JVM内部优化。 使用Lambda表达式:Ja
input("a=") input("b=") input("c=")在python中如何优化
input("a="), input("b="), input("c=") 在 Python 中的优化可以通过以下几个方面实现: 类型转换:由于 input() 函数默认返回字符串类型,直接进行算术运算会导致 TypeError。因此,可以在读取输入后立即进行类型转换。例如,可以使用 int(input("a="))、`int(input